6-Wire Instructions Power and Gate Operator

Router
Ethernet Switch

1. Wire main power from the transformer to the power connector on the circuit board.
2. Connect gate trigger wires from the Normally Open (NO) and Common (C) to the free-exit or exit terminals on the gate operator.
3. Connect the gate status wires on the 6-pin connector on the main relay and input plug to the magnetic switch or a Dry Contact, Normally Closed (NC) relay on the gate operator.

4. If using an optional 26-bit reader (keypad, card reader, RFID, or clicker), wire the device to the Wiegand connection on the interface circuit board.

5. Use Camera Guide if adding optional external camera.

6. Test/activate using the test credentials on the Activation & Test
Process document.

Expansion Boards
Install One Expansion Board
The WXL allows the addition of an expansion board. Expansion Board with 6″ cable and mounting hardware Part#: CB-WIM 2000 Metal Mounting Plate (with 15-inch cable) Part #: CB-WIM 4000
Power off the device before you begin!
Installation
1. Use the key to open the WXL box. The Industrial Ethernet Switch is labeled.

Mounting Plate

2. Unscrew and remove the Ethernet switch. Set the screws aside so you can use them to reattach the plate.

3. Install the mounting plate using the screws from the Ethernet switch.
Expansion Board 1 has jumpers on R36, R35, and R34. Ensure that Board 1 is on the right.

Install this side toward the top of box

Board 1

Board 1

If you’ve ordered expansion boards, they may be already installed.

Jumpers: R36, R35, R34
8

4. Reattach the Ethernet switch, port side-up, in the center of the expansion board using the screws from the shipment.
5. Connect the cables included in the shipment and the Ethernet switch.
6. Connect the expansion board to the RS485 and original WXL circuit board, as shown below. Close the box and reattach it next to the gate. You are now ready to use your WXL.
The RS485 is on the right. The internal Wiegand port is on the left.
Do not plug the expansion board into the Wiegand.

Add Another Expansion Board
1. Unscrew and remove the Ethernet switch. Set the screws aside so you can use them to reattach the switch.
2. Ensure that Board 1 is on the right and Board 2 is on the left. Expansion Board 1 has jumpers on R36, R35, and R34. Expansion Board 2 has jumpers on R36 and R35 (see below).
Board 2

Board 2

Install this side toward the top of box

Board 1

Board 1

Jumpers: R36, R35
3. Reattach the Ethernet switch, port side-up, in the center of the expansion board.
4. Connect the board with the jumper cables.

Jumpers: R36, R35, R34
10

5. Install Expansion Board 2 on the left side of the mounting plate. Check that you have jumpers on R34 and R35. Connect the expansion board to the RS485 and original WXL circuit board, as shown below. Close the box and remount it. You are now ready to use your
WXL.

Magnetic Switch Setup
Gate statuses can be inverted. If needed, please call CellGate to invert.
The Mag Switch can be placed anywhere that allows A and B to be pulled at least 2 inches away from each other when the gate is open and within 1.5 inches when the gate is closed.

Testing
1. Enter the Testing Code, then tap the Enter. The Code activates Relay 1 (the gate should open).
2. From the Home screen, tap Directory to open the directory, which lists all callgroups.
3. Tap a callgroup to initiate call. An automated message will play confirming the call was successful.
